Decentralized Fairness Aware Multi Task Federated Learning for VR Network

无线连接为虚拟现实(VR)体验带来灵活性,使用户可随时随地参与。然而,由于体验质量要求严苛、低延迟限制及设备能力有限,实现无缝、高质量、实时的无线VR视频传输仍具挑战。本文提出一种去中心化多任务公平联邦学习(DMTFL)驱动的缓存机制,在基站(BS)端根据各自特性定制缓存策略,预取每个用户的视场(FOV)。传统联邦学习常偏向特定用户,单一全局模型难以捕捉用户与基站间的统计异质性。本文所提算法通过在各基站本地学习个性化缓存模型,并优化其在任意目标分布下的表现,同时提供基于Rademacher复杂度和损失的可能近似正确(PAC)边界理论保证。基于真实VR头动追踪数据集的仿真表明,所提DMTFL算法显著优于基线方法。

Wireless connectivity promises to unshackle virtual reality (VR) experiences, allowing users to engage from anywhere, anytime. However, delivering seamless, high-quality, real-time VR video wirelessly is challenging due to the stringent quality of experience requirements, low latency constraints, and limited VR device capabilities. This paper addresses these challenges by introducing a novel decentralized multi task fair federated learning (DMTFL) based caching that caches and prefetches each VR user's field of view (FOV) at base stations (BSs) based on the caching strategies tailored to each BS. In federated learning (FL) in its naive form, often biases toward certain users, and a single global model fails to capture the statistical heterogeneity across users and BSs. In contrast, the proposed DMTFL algorithm personalizes content delivery by learning individual caching models at each BS. These models are further optimized to perform well under any target distribution, while providing theoretical guarantees via Rademacher complexity and a probably approximately correct (PAC) bound on the loss. Using a realistic VR head-tracking dataset, our simulations demonstrate the superiority of our proposed DMTFL algorithm compared to baseline algorithms.
